Output 673659844ee28c41905373c11a734a25649e1b4fc5c0efa6e106b96ddea2e1d3:1

value
4355629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a600d8c21357ffabd3746298b999fa3aeb93e69d OP_EQUAL
address
3Gpm7Dc5PUc7f74faKoguzrhmNHCPYPjrP
transaction
673659844ee28c41905373c11a734a25649e1b4fc5c0efa6e106b96ddea2e1d3